Subject: Cutover from legacy job queue to Relayline

Hi team,

We're retiring the homegrown queue (fanout-d) on the Harborgate integration this month and moving all partner jobs to Relayline. Enqueue semantics stay the same, but retries are now handled server-side, so please stop advising partners to re-submit manually. Failed jobs land in a dead-letter view your support console can read directly. For verifying partner job status during the transition, authenticate against the Relayline status endpoint with the following bearer token:

portal login ticket: eyJhbGciOiJIUzI1NiIsInR5cCI6IkpXVCJ9.eyJzdWIiOiIwEOsktwVNwIn0.-UJU3fdyyCgG

MEMO — Kettling Depot Receiving

Uniform sets for the new Kettling depot arrive Wednesday via Ashgrove courier: 40 boxes, sorted by size, manifest attached to box one. Check the count at the dock before signing; shortages go straight to stores, not the courier. The hand-over instruction the courier will follow is set out below.

drop instructions, tafof-baguf: the holmir gilox courier leaves the sormir ulaok holdor ledger at gate 5596 under passcode 257343

Runbook: Tidewell flag rollouts. To pause a rollout, set `TIDEWELL_ROLLOUT_STATE=halted` and redeploy the evaluator pods — takes about two minutes. Never edit cohort percentages directly in the database; the evaluator will overwrite them. All evaluator instances authenticate to the Tidewell control API with a shared token defined in the env file, and the line right after this entry sets that token.

env line for fafof-fahag: LEDGER_TOKEN5=f8790